    Most of the time, I want my sound coming through my MS Lifechat headphones so that I don't bug the rest of the family. But occasionally I'd like to listen using the Altec Lansing speakers in the HP docking station I have for my Pavilion tx 1000. I'm running Vista Premium.

    I can't seem to find anything that will let me switch between these short of pulling out the USB plug for the Lifechat headphones. Is there some other way to do this?

    Right click on the speaker icon in your taskbar and go to 'Playback Devices'. It should list the two outputs if they are connected. You can disable either one by right clicking and selecting disable.

    Well, close. Actually in my case it showed the USB device and the two others (the internal speakers and the external are evidently different even though it is the same sound card), and I had to click the one I wanted and set it to default. It would not let me disable or change the active one, so I had to go to the inactive one.

    However, it otherwise is as you described. Thanks!
